A Shepherd for the Lord's Flock


Quote from Letter 7,39 to Marinianus, bishop of Ravenna. July 597

(T)he statues of the sacred canons do not permit a church to remain without a bishop form more than three months, in case, with the loss of the shepherd, the ancient enemy (Heaven forbid!) may lie in wait and tear apart the Lord's flock.
And so, your Fraternity should consent to their [the fathfull of the church of Imola] entreaty, and consecrate a bishop in plave of the lapsed one. 
For, while you should have advised and encouraged them to do this, even before they had asked you, you ought not to put them off with any excuse as thhey ask you. For a church of God should not remain deprived of its own bishop for a long time.




Cited from: The Letters of Gregory the Great, trans. John R.C. Martyn (Toronto: PIMS, 2004), II, 495
